Optical fiber remains the dominant segment due to its high capacity, low latency, and reliability, making it the preferred choice for connecting large-scale data centers across urban and suburban regions. Microwave wireless solutions are gaining traction in specific scenarios requiring rapid deployment or where fiber installation faces logistical challenges, positioning them as a niche but growing segment. Hybrid solutions, integrating fiber and wireless technologies, are emerging as innovative options to address diverse connectivity needs, especially in remote or underserved areas. South Korea Data Center Interconnect Network Market By Application Segment Analysis The application landscape for DCI networks in South Korea is primarily segmented into enterprise data center connectivity, cloud service provider interconnections, and content delivery networks (CDNs). Enterprise data centers utilize DCI solutions to ensure seamless data sharing, disaster recovery, and business continuity across multiple locations. Cloud service providers leverage DCI to interconnect their geographically dispersed data centers, enabling scalable cloud services and reducing latency. CDNs depend heavily on robust DCI infrastructure to deliver high-quality content and streaming services efficiently to end-users, especially given South Korea’s high internet penetration and digital consumption rates. Competitive Landscape Analysis of South Korea Data Center Interconnect Network Market The competitive landscape is characterized by a mix of global technology giants, regional telecom operators, and specialized interconnect solution providers. Leading players such as Cisco, Huawei, and Nokia dominate the fiber-optic and DWDM (Dense Wavelength Division Multiplexing) segments, leveraging their technological expertise and extensive regional presence. South Korean telecom operators like KT and SK Telecom are increasingly investing in in-house interconnect infrastructure and forming strategic alliances with international vendors to enhance their offerings. The market also witnesses a surge in local startups focusing on innovative SDN (Software-Defined Networking) and network automation solutions, aiming to optimize data flow and reduce operational costs. Technological Disruption & Innovation in South Korea Data Center Interconnect Network Market Emerging technologies such as SDN, NFV (Network Functions Virtualization), and AI-driven network management are revolutionizing the South Korea DCI landscape. These innovations enable dynamic, programmable, and automated network configurations, significantly reducing operational complexity and costs. Furthermore, the adoption of photonic integrated circuits (PICs) and advancements in coherent optical transmission are enhancing data throughput and energy efficiency. The deployment of 5G edge computing infrastructure necessitates ultra-low latency interconnect solutions, prompting vendors to develop innovative, scalable architectures. The integration of AI for predictive maintenance and security analytics is also transforming the operational paradigm, ensuring resilient and adaptive networks capable of supporting South Korea’s digital ambitions. Regulatory Framework & Policy Impact on South Korea Data Center Interconnect Market South Korea’s regulatory environment is highly supportive of digital infrastructure development, with policies emphasizing data sovereignty, cybersecurity, and green energy initiatives. The government’s Digital New Deal emphasizes investments in high-speed connectivity and data centers, fostering a conducive environment for market growth. Regulations around data privacy and cross-border data flow influence interconnect architecture choices and vendor strategies. Policies promoting renewable energy use in data centers are driving investments in energy-efficient interconnect solutions, aligning with ESG goals. Additionally, spectrum management and licensing policies impact the deployment of optical and wireless interconnect technologies, shaping the technological landscape and competitive dynamics within the market. Emerging Business Models in South Korea Data Center Interconnect Network Market Innovative business models such as Network-as-a-Service (NaaS) and managed interconnect solutions are gaining traction, offering flexible, scalable options for enterprise clients. These models enable rapid deployment and cost-effective scaling, aligning with the dynamic needs of digital enterprises. Partnership-driven models, including joint ventures between telecom operators and cloud providers, are fostering integrated service offerings. Additionally, the rise of open networking and SDN-based platforms is facilitating vendor-neutral interconnect solutions, promoting interoperability and customization. These emerging models are transforming traditional CAPEX-heavy infrastructure investments into OPEX-driven, service-oriented approaches, unlocking new revenue streams and market opportunities.
